Section 38-D:5 - Appropriations Authorized.

Universal Citation: NH Rev Stat § 38-D:5 (2021)
    38-D:5 Appropriations Authorized. –
I. A town or city, having established an energy commission, may appropriate money as necessary for the purpose of this chapter. All or any part of money so appropriated in any year and any gifts of money received under this chapter may be placed in an energy commission fund and allowed to accumulate from year to year. Money may be expended from such fund by the energy commission for the purposes of this chapter without further approval of the town meeting; however, acceptance of gifts over $500 and disbursements over $500 shall require a public hearing with notice under RSA 675:7 and approval of the governing body.
II. The town treasurer, under RSA 41:29, shall have custody of all moneys in the energy fund and shall pay out the same only upon order of the energy commission. The disbursement of energy commission funds following the approval required under paragraph I shall be authorized by a majority of the energy commission.

Source. 2009, 275:1, eff. Sept. 27, 2009.
